The UGLY WALL is finally coming down! HOPEFULLY! The wall I am referring to is the wall along Navarro and Augusta streets which are close the Central Public Library. The wall belongs to the Ursuline Campus of the Art School.
The funny thing is that I never cease to think about that wall being torn down, and today I got my wish, well, sort of. Today, I saw a sign posted near that wall announcing of a hearing by the City Council about replacing the wall entirely by a new one. However, if the wall gets replaced it's going to be one of the most difficult things to do because of the many trees that are growing behind the wall, and are growing very near to it. I believe that the trees are the ones that have shifted the wall to a near 45 degree angle in some places. Not to mention, it is very unattractive. The trees are very beautiful, but they are going to have to be sacrificed, and be uprooted by the City. I walk alongside that wall sometimes, and I have to move away from it because it leans over the sidewalk. Mr. Castro, tear down this WALL!
